Former Tottenham captain Graham Roberts is unimpressed by Emmanuel Adebayor this season.
Roberts, 53, wants to see more from the Togo forward as Spurs chase a top-four spot and Champions League qualification.
He said: "Adebayor has got to do more. He's a striker and he has to score 20 goals a season.
"If you're going to qualify for the Champions League and you're going to try and win trophies then your strikers have to be scoring goals.
"He's been disappointing this year. He's let the supporters down and he's let the manager down."
